Despite advertising, vaping presents significant medical risks . While often presented as a alternative to traditional cigarettes , the future effects of inhaling e-liquids remain significantly uncertain. Recent research suggests a connection between electronic cigarette and lung damage , cardiovascular disease , and addiction to the chemical. Furthermore, the existence of toxic substances, including additives like certain chemicals, raises questions about possible harm. It's important to understand that vaping isn't without danger and requires cautious consideration before trying it.

Electronic Cigarettes and Your Well-being – What You Must Understand
While e-cigarette use is often described as a reduced-risk choice to regular tobacco, it's essential to understand the likely hazards to your physical condition. These systems introduce the addictive substance nicotine, which can addict people, especially teenage people. Furthermore, the future effects of electronic smoking are still actively investigated, but preliminary findings points to possible damage to the respiratory system and cardiovascular system. It's vital to remain informed and discuss a healthcare provider about the likely effects for your personal health before trying vaping.
New Regulations Target the Vape Industry
A substantial shift is underway as recent rules target the electronic cigarette market. Regulators are addressing concerns regarding the health effects of such products, particularly on youth individuals. The steps include more stringent limitations on advertising, flavorings, and distribution of e-cig goods.
- Increased taxes are being considered.
- Age verification procedures are being enhanced.
- Warnings on labels will become more noticeable.
These efforts symbolize a larger drive to reduce vaping consumption and safeguard community safety.
Stopping Vaping: Methods for Achievement
Breaking free from e-cigarette habit can be a tough journey, but it's absolutely achievable with the right strategies. Consider creating a support system, which might involve friends, relatives or a professional therapist. NRT replacement, like lozenges, can help manage desires, and gradually decreasing your replacement dose is often effective. Identifying your triggers – the circumstances that encourage e-cig – and establishing managing approaches to manage them is also crucial. Remember to acknowledge milestones along the way and do not be downhearted by setbacks; they are a typical aspect of the process.
